Study System at the College


Study at College follows levels system, dividing the academic year into two main semesters. The graduation requirements for being awarded the degree are divided into levels, as per the study plan acknowledged by the University Board, without exceeding the minimum or maximum of allowed study burden. Study at Engineering College shall be submit to study and testing regulations at university stage, as well as the executive rules in force at Princess Nourah Bint Abdulrahman University. (Click Here)

The programs of Engineering College require completing not less than 162 credit hours, distributed over 10 semesters and one field practical training. Students are accepted at Engineering College's foundation year then students choose major as per the mechanism announced at the page of Deanship of Admission and Registration, for one of the following programs:

Biomedical Engineering serves as an interface between engineering and medicine. This major concentrates on designing and maintaining medical appliances of different categories, to help physicians to get accurate diagnosis of pathological cases and then to prescribe the appropriate medications, contributing to speed recovery and realizing positive results.

Biomedical Engineering combines also biomedical, physiological & engineering sciences, such as: computer science, electrical engineering and mechanical engineering. The ultimate objective is to understand the nature of diseases from all aspects, deal with them, and then design appropriate medical and prosthetic devices.

 

The program qualifies graduates to work in designing, maintaining and developing medical appliances, controlling their quality systems and medical measurement systems.
